Tom kratman is a retired us army officer turned science and military fiction author. In addition to caliphate, baen has published his novels, a state of disobedience, a desert called peace and its sequel carnifex, and three collaborations with john ringo in the posleen war series, watch on the rhine, yellow eyes and the tuloriad.
